| Check | GMGN | WunderTrading |
|---|---|---|
| Fee model | 1% | 0.035% |
| Free tier | not published | Lifetime Free plan (no time limit): 10 API keys per exchange, 1 Multi-API trade, 1 Signal bot, 1 DCA bot, 1 Grid bot, 50 open positions |
| Paid plans | not published | Tiers: Free, Basic, Pro, Premium; annual billing up to 25% off. Dollar prices are API-rendered and absent from HTML — not citable from this harvest |
| Supported exchanges | 4 chains: Solana, BSC, Base, Ethereum (on-chain DEX terminal, not CEX aggregator) | not published |
| Key features | Multi-chain meme trading terminal; smart-money copy trading; new token monitoring; security audit; wallet P&L analytics; Telegram sniper/swap/alert bots | Bots: TradingView, Signal, DCA, GRID, Market Neutral, AI Trading; plus Trading Terminal, Spreads & Arbitrage, Multi-Exchange Trading, Demo Trading, Pump Screener, MCP Server. No copy trading found |
| Founded | not published | Operating since 2019 (site claim 'Trusted by Traders since 2019') |
| Availability | accepts Malaysia | accepts Malaysia |
| Official source | GMGN official website | WunderTrading official website |
Using GMGN or WunderTrading from Malaysia
Signing up from Malaysia puts GMGN and WunderTrading under a local rulebook, and it is not what the fee table alone tells you. Securities Commission Malaysia (SC), the statutory body regulating Malaysia's capital markets (digital asset exchanges fall under securities law). Digital asset exchanges serving Malaysia are registered by the Securities Commission Malaysia as Recognized Market Operators (RMO) to establish and operate a digital asset exchange (DAX); running a DAX without SC authorisation is an offence under securities laws. How money actually reaches the order book here: DuitNow instant account-to-account transfer (Real-time Retail Payments Platform run by PayNet): instant send/receive using a mobile number or DuitNow ID across participating banks and e-wallets. DuitNow transfers cost nothing up to RM5,000; above that a 50 sen fee applies, and many banks waive it. Available via internet and mobile banking at banks nationwide and participating e-wallets. On tax treatment in this market: Income from active crypto activities such as trading, mining and exchange is subject to Malaysian income tax, with digital currencies classified as commodities that can constitute business income (Ministry of Finance, parliamentary reply).
